     17 #ifndef STAGEFRIGHT_RECORDER_H_
     18 
     19 #define STAGEFRIGHT_RECORDER_H_
     20 
     21 #include <media/MediaRecorderBase.h>
     22 #include <camera/CameraParameters.h>
     23 #include <utils/String8.h>
     24 
     25 #include <system/audio.h>
     26 
     27 namespace android {
     28 
     29 class Camera;
     30 class ICameraRecordingProxy;
     31 class CameraSource;
     32 class CameraSourceTimeLapse;
     33 struct MediaSource;
     34 struct MediaWriter;
     35 class MetaData;
     36 struct AudioSource;
     37 class MediaProfiles;
     38 class IGraphicBufferProducer;
     39 class SurfaceMediaSource;
     40 
     41 struct StagefrightRecorder : public MediaRecorderBase {
     42     StagefrightRecorder();
     43     virtual ~StagefrightRecorder();
     44 
     45     virtual status_t init();
     46     virtual status_t setAudioSource(audio_source_t as);
     47     virtual status_t setVideoSource(video_source vs);
     48     virtual status_t setOutputFormat(output_format of);
     49     virtual status_t setAudioEncoder(audio_encoder ae);
     50     virtual status_t setVideoEncoder(video_encoder ve);
     51     virtual status_t setVideoSize(int width, int height);
     52     virtual status_t setVideoFrameRate(int frames_per_second);
     53     virtual status_t setCamera(const sp<ICamera>& camera, const sp<ICameraRecordingProxy>& proxy);
     54     virtual status_t setPreviewSurface(const sp<IGraphicBufferProducer>& surface);
     55     virtual status_t setOutputFile(const char *path);
     56     virtual status_t setOutputFile(int fd, int64_t offset, int64_t length);
     57     virtual status_t setParameters(const String8& params);
     58     virtual status_t setListener(const sp<IMediaRecorderClient>& listener);
     59     virtual status_t setClientName(const String16& clientName);
     60     virtual status_t prepare();
     61     virtual status_t start();
     62     virtual status_t pause();
     63     virtual status_t stop();
     64     virtual status_t close();
     65     virtual status_t reset();
     66     virtual status_t getMaxAmplitude(int *max);
     67     virtual status_t dump(int fd, const Vector<String16>& args) const;
     68     // Querying a SurfaceMediaSourcer
     69     virtual sp<IGraphicBufferProducer> querySurfaceMediaSource() const;
     70 
     71 private:
     72     sp<ICamera> mCamera;
     73     sp<ICameraRecordingProxy> mCameraProxy;
     74     sp<IGraphicBufferProducer> mPreviewSurface;
     75     sp<IMediaRecorderClient> mListener;
     76     String16 mClientName;
     77     uid_t mClientUid;
     78     sp<MediaWriter> mWriter;
     79     int mOutputFd;
     80     sp<AudioSource> mAudioSourceNode;
     81 
     82     audio_source_t mAudioSource;
     83     video_source mVideoSource;
     84     output_format mOutputFormat;
     85     audio_encoder mAudioEncoder;
     86     video_encoder mVideoEncoder;
     87     bool mUse64BitFileOffset;
     88     int32_t mVideoWidth, mVideoHeight;
     89     int32_t mFrameRate;
     90     int32_t mVideoBitRate;
     91     int32_t mAudioBitRate;
     92     int32_t mAudioChannels;
     93     int32_t mSampleRate;
     94     int32_t mInterleaveDurationUs;
     95     int32_t mIFramesIntervalSec;
     96     int32_t mCameraId;
     97     int32_t mVideoEncoderProfile;
     98     int32_t mVideoEncoderLevel;
     99     int32_t mMovieTimeScale;
    100     int32_t mVideoTimeScale;
    101     int32_t mAudioTimeScale;
    102     int64_t mMaxFileSizeBytes;
    103     int64_t mMaxFileDurationUs;
    104     int64_t mTrackEveryTimeDurationUs;
    105     int32_t mRotationDegrees;  // Clockwise
    106     int32_t mLatitudex10000;
    107     int32_t mLongitudex10000;
    108     int32_t mStartTimeOffsetMs;
    109 
    110     bool mCaptureTimeLapse;
    111     int64_t mTimeBetweenTimeLapseFrameCaptureUs;
    112     sp<CameraSourceTimeLapse> mCameraSourceTimeLapse;
    113 
    114 
    115     String8 mParams;
    116 
    117     bool mIsMetaDataStoredInVideoBuffers;
    118     MediaProfiles *mEncoderProfiles;
    119 
    120     bool mStarted;
    121     // Needed when GLFrames are encoded.
    122     // An <IGraphicBufferProducer> pointer
    123     // will be sent to the client side using which the
    124     // frame buffers will be queued and dequeued
    125     sp<SurfaceMediaSource> mSurfaceMediaSource;
    126 
    127     status_t setupMPEG4Recording(
    128         int outputFd,
    129         int32_t videoWidth, int32_t videoHeight,
    130         int32_t videoBitRate,
    131         int32_t *totalBitRate,
    132         sp<MediaWriter> *mediaWriter);
    133     void setupMPEG4MetaData(int64_t startTimeUs, int32_t totalBitRate,
    134         sp<MetaData> *meta);
    135     status_t startMPEG4Recording();
    136     status_t startAMRRecording();
    137     status_t startAACRecording();
    138     status_t startRawAudioRecording();
    139     status_t startRTPRecording();
    140     status_t startMPEG2TSRecording();
    141     sp<MediaSource> createAudioSource();
    142     status_t checkVideoEncoderCapabilities();
    143     status_t checkAudioEncoderCapabilities();
    144     // Generic MediaSource set-up. Returns the appropriate
    145     // source (CameraSource or SurfaceMediaSource)
    146     // depending on the videosource type
    147     status_t setupMediaSource(sp<MediaSource> *mediaSource);
    148     status_t setupCameraSource(sp<CameraSource> *cameraSource);
    149     // setup the surfacemediasource for the encoder
    150     status_t setupSurfaceMediaSource();
    151 
    152     status_t setupAudioEncoder(const sp<MediaWriter>& writer);
    153     status_t setupVideoEncoder(
    154             sp<MediaSource> cameraSource,
    155             int32_t videoBitRate,
    156             sp<MediaSource> *source);
    157 
    158     // Encoding parameter handling utilities
    159     status_t setParameter(const String8 &key, const String8 &value);
    160     status_t setParamAudioEncodingBitRate(int32_t bitRate);
    161     status_t setParamAudioNumberOfChannels(int32_t channles);
    162     status_t setParamAudioSamplingRate(int32_t sampleRate);
    163     status_t setParamAudioTimeScale(int32_t timeScale);
    164     status_t setParamTimeLapseEnable(int32_t timeLapseEnable);
    165     status_t setParamTimeBetweenTimeLapseFrameCapture(int64_t timeUs);
    166     status_t setParamVideoEncodingBitRate(int32_t bitRate);
    167     status_t setParamVideoIFramesInterval(int32_t seconds);
    168     status_t setParamVideoEncoderProfile(int32_t profile);
    169     status_t setParamVideoEncoderLevel(int32_t level);
    170     status_t setParamVideoCameraId(int32_t cameraId);
    171     status_t setParamVideoTimeScale(int32_t timeScale);
    172     status_t setParamVideoRotation(int32_t degrees);
    173     status_t setParamTrackTimeStatus(int64_t timeDurationUs);
    174     status_t setParamInterleaveDuration(int32_t durationUs);
    175     status_t setParam64BitFileOffset(bool use64BitFileOffset);
    176     status_t setParamMaxFileDurationUs(int64_t timeUs);
    177     status_t setParamMaxFileSizeBytes(int64_t bytes);
    178     status_t setParamMovieTimeScale(int32_t timeScale);
    179     status_t setParamGeoDataLongitude(int64_t longitudex10000);
    180     status_t setParamGeoDataLatitude(int64_t latitudex10000);
    181     void clipVideoBitRate();
    182     void clipVideoFrameRate();
    183     void clipVideoFrameWidth();
    184     void clipVideoFrameHeight();
    185     void clipAudioBitRate();
    186     void clipAudioSampleRate();
    187     void clipNumberOfAudioChannels();
    188     void setDefaultProfileIfNecessary();
    189 
    190 
    191     StagefrightRecorder(const StagefrightRecorder &);
    192     StagefrightRecorder &operator=(const StagefrightRecorder &);
    193 };
    194 
    195 }  // namespace android
    196 
    197 #endif  // STAGEFRIGHT_RECORDER_H_
